 Although their numbers have been building for past couple of days, today (Nov. 
26) was really wild. There was a feeding frenzy that included about 200+ Cedar 
Waxwings, 40-50 American Robins and a couple of Eastern Bluebirds.

These birds are feeding on the "pears" of a Bradford Pear next to the fish pond 
at my home on Simerly Creek. I can't recall ever hosting such a large flock of 
waxwings.
